City Guide
Herre, Telemark, Norway
Overview
Herre is a picturesque small village in Telemark, Norway, set by the scenic Frierfjorden. Known for its peaceful atmosphere, charming wooden homes, and beautiful coastal surroundings, it offers an authentic Norwegian rural experience.
Best Time to Visit
June-August for mild weather and long daylight hours.
Local Tips
Have cash or card as some places are cashless. Grocery stores close early on weekends, so plan your shopping ahead.
Cultural Etiquette
Norwegians value personal space and quietness. Tipping is not mandatory but appreciated (about 5-10% in restaurants). Dress casually but neatly.
Safety Warnings
Herre is considered very safe. Exercise standard caution in outdoor areas, especially near water and during winter when paths may be icy.
Hidden Gems
Explore the lesser-known hiking trails along Frierfjorden or visit the small local art gallery occasionally open in summer.
